Abstract
The utility model discloses a pure electric vehicles multi-box battery heating circuit, including the battery box of several series connection, switching relay, heating relay and the discharge relay of series connection are equipped with from the positive terminal to the negative pole end in the battery box, and switching relay includes change over switch and first coil, and heating relay includes heating switch and second coil, and the discharge relay includes discharge switch and third coil; two ends of the first coil, the second coil and the third coil are connected to a low-voltage power supply; a first movable contact of the change-over switch is connected with a fixed contact of the heating switch, a movable contact of the heating switch is connected with a fixed contact of the discharging switch, and a second movable contact of the change-over switch is connected with a fixed contact of the heating switch; the fixed contact of the change-over switch is used as the positive terminal of the battery box, and the movable contact of the discharge switch is used as the negative terminal of the battery box. The number of high-voltage plug connectors on the battery box is reduced, wiring harnesses between the battery boxes are simplified, and the cost of the whole vehicle battery system is reduced.
